.sr-only[data-v-9958fa6f]{height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px;clip:rect(0,0,0,0);border:0;white-space:nowrap}.explore-products[data-v-9958fa6f]{margin:0 1%;max-width:1440px;width:100%}.explore-products__container[data-v-9958fa6f]{display:flex;flex-direction:column;gap:24px}.tabs-section[data-v-9958fa6f]{align-items:flex-end;border-bottom:2px solid var(--color-primary-90,rgba(0,39,175,.1));display:flex;gap:16px;justify-content:space-between;padding-bottom:16px}.tabs-wrapper[data-v-9958fa6f]{align-items:center;display:flex;gap:32px}.tab-button[data-v-9958fa6f]{align-items:center;background:transparent;border:none;color:var(--color-text-secondary,#666);cursor:pointer;display:inline-flex;font-family:var(--font-family-primary,"Inter",sans-serif);font-size:18px;font-weight:600;gap:12px;padding:0 0 12px;position:relative;transition:color .2s ease}.tab-button[data-v-9958fa6f]:after{background:transparent;border-radius:999px;bottom:-18px;content:"";height:3px;left:0;position:absolute;right:0;transform:scaleX(0);transition:transform .2s ease,background .2s ease}.tab-button[data-v-9958fa6f]:hover{color:var(--color-primary-40,#0027af)}.tab-button__label[data-v-9958fa6f]{color:inherit}.tab-button__count[data-v-9958fa6f]{align-items:center;background:var(--color-primary-95,rgba(0,39,175,.05));border-radius:999px;display:inline-flex;font-size:15px;font-weight:600;height:32px;justify-content:center;min-width:32px;padding:0 12px}.tab-button--active[data-v-9958fa6f],.tab-button__count[data-v-9958fa6f]{color:var(--color-primary-40,#0027af)}.tab-button--active[data-v-9958fa6f]:after{background:var(--color-primary-40,#0027af);transform:scaleX(1)}.tab-button--active .tab-button__count[data-v-9958fa6f]{background:var(--color-primary-90,rgba(0,39,175,.1))}.filter-chips-loading[data-v-9958fa6f]{display:flex;flex-wrap:wrap;gap:12px;padding:16px 0}.filter-chip-skeleton[data-v-9958fa6f]{animation:shimmer-9958fa6f 1.5s infinite;background:linear-gradient(90deg,#f0f0f0 25%,#e8e8e8 37%,#f0f0f0 63%);background-size:400% 100%;border-radius:8px;flex:1;height:88px;min-width:100px}.slide-up-enter-active[data-v-9958fa6f],.slide-up-leave-active[data-v-9958fa6f]{overflow:hidden;transition:all .3s ease}.slide-up-enter-from[data-v-9958fa6f]{margin-bottom:0;max-height:0;opacity:0;transform:translateY(-20px)}.slide-up-enter-to[data-v-9958fa6f],.slide-up-leave-from[data-v-9958fa6f]{max-height:200px;opacity:1;transform:translateY(0)}.slide-up-leave-to[data-v-9958fa6f]{margin-bottom:0;max-height:0;opacity:0;transform:translateY(-20px)}.fade-slide-enter-active[data-v-9958fa6f],.fade-slide-leave-active[data-v-9958fa6f]{transition:opacity .3s ease,transform .3s ease}.fade-slide-enter-from[data-v-9958fa6f]{opacity:0;transform:translateY(10px)}.fade-slide-enter-to[data-v-9958fa6f],.fade-slide-leave-from[data-v-9958fa6f]{opacity:1;transform:translateY(0)}.fade-slide-leave-to[data-v-9958fa6f]{opacity:0;transform:translateY(10px)}.products-grid[data-v-9958fa6f]{display:grid;gap:16px;grid-template-columns:repeat(3,1fr);width:100%}.fd-cards-container[data-v-9958fa6f]{flex-wrap:wrap;gap:20px;width:100%}.empty-state[data-v-9958fa6f],.fd-cards-container[data-v-9958fa6f]{display:flex;justify-content:center}.empty-state[data-v-9958fa6f]{grid-column:1/-1}.empty-state[data-v-9958fa6f],.empty-state-fd[data-v-9958fa6f]{align-items:center;flex-direction:column;min-height:300px;padding:60px 20px;text-align:center}.empty-state-fd[data-v-9958fa6f]{display:flex;justify-content:center;width:100%}.empty-state-icon[data-v-9958fa6f]{font-size:64px;margin-bottom:16px;opacity:.6}.empty-state-title[data-v-9958fa6f]{color:var(--primaryText,#1b2559);font-size:20px;font-weight:600;margin-bottom:8px}.empty-state-message[data-v-9958fa6f]{color:var(--secondaryText,#666);font-size:14px;line-height:1.5;max-width:500px}.skeleton[data-v-9958fa6f]{animation:shimmer-9958fa6f 1.5s infinite;background:linear-gradient(90deg,#f0f0f0 25%,#e8e8e8 37%,#f0f0f0 63%);background-size:400% 100%;border-radius:7px;height:230px;width:100%}@keyframes shimmer-9958fa6f{0%{background-position:-400px 0}to{background-position:400px 0}}.scroll-sentinel[data-v-9958fa6f]{height:1px;margin:20px 0;width:100%}.loading-more[data-v-9958fa6f]{margin-top:24px;width:100%}.end-of-results[data-v-9958fa6f]{color:var(--color-text-secondary,#666);font-size:14px;grid-column:1/-1;padding:40px 20px;text-align:center}@media (max-width:1024px){.explore-products[data-v-9958fa6f]{padding:5% 24px 24px}.products-grid[data-v-9958fa6f]{align-items:center;display:flex;flex-direction:column}}@media (max-width:768px){.explore-products[data-v-9958fa6f]{padding:5% 16px 16px}.tabs-section[data-v-9958fa6f]{gap:8px;padding-bottom:12px}.tabs-wrapper[data-v-9958fa6f]{flex:1;gap:16px;min-width:0}.tab-button[data-v-9958fa6f]{font-size:14px;gap:8px;padding-bottom:10px}.tab-button[data-v-9958fa6f]:after{bottom:-13px;height:2px}.tab-button__count[data-v-9958fa6f]{font-size:12px;height:24px;min-width:24px;padding:0 8px}.products-grid[data-v-9958fa6f]{gap:16px;grid-template-columns:1fr}.explore-products-section[data-v-9958fa6f]{padding:30px 0}}@media (max-width:480px){.explore-products[data-v-9958fa6f]{overflow-x:hidden;padding:10% 12px 12px}.tabs-section[data-v-9958fa6f]{gap:6px}.tabs-wrapper[data-v-9958fa6f]{gap:12px}.tab-button[data-v-9958fa6f]{font-size:13px;gap:6px}.tab-button__count[data-v-9958fa6f]{font-size:11px;height:20px;min-width:20px;padding:0 6px}.products-grid[data-v-9958fa6f]{gap:12px}}
